A badugi is a hand of four cards that does not contain the same suit, the same value, or the same rank as the player. An ace has a value of 1. However, a badugi does not assure a win because the other players have lower badugi hands.

Another term for betting is checking. It is permitted when there are no pending stakes. A person can check to see if he doesn't want to deposit any money.

The first round will be based on the first deal. The dealer will then deal the first round of community card face-ups to the table after the betting card poker. The Flop is the first round, and it exposes three cards. The dealer's left player is the first to bet again. Any player who does not want to call, or agree to pay, the bet, forfeits his cards and exits the game. All remaining players view the Turn, which is the fourth card in the community. After the betting ends, the River unveils the final community card. The final bets were placed and the remaining poker players revealed their 5-card hands.

Omaha Hold'em combines community cards with poker. It's similar in some ways to Texas Hold'em. But it has some twists. To build a hand, individuals are dealt four cards. They must use at most two of the community cards as well as three from the cards dealt to them.

Joseph Crowell, an English actor who was born in 1829, wrote that the game was played in New Orleans. The game involved four players who each bet on the hand with the highest value. An Exposure of the Arts and Miseries of Gambling is a book that describes how the game spread from New Orleans through the Mississippi riverboats. Gambling was widespread in the region.
